First check with your medical provider, since I think some don't recommend starting a new type of workout that you weren't doing before pregnancy. Yoga would probably be the "gentler" one to ease into, and there are several pregnancy yoga workouts that you can do. :flower:
 
If you worked out regularly before pregnancy, then really, I'd think either would be ok. You'll have to modify as your tummy grows-- but I've done both, and neither are that intense (although Pilates involves more movements to strengthen muscles)- it involves less downward positions (least the classes I've taken). Think it depends what you are looking to achieve. Yoga is great for flexibility and strength and comes in many forms.

Pilates is more directed to core stabilty, core strength and focuses on posture.

Both can have exercises that are not always appropriate for everyone so make sure you chat with the instructor.

A good teacher should correct your technique x
